Workers Comp
Provides medical expenses and lost wages for employees that are injured or become ill due to a work related incident.
Inland Marine (Equipment)
Protects tools and equipment while being transported or stored away from your business.
Small Business
Business Owners (BOP)
Combines essential coverages, such as property and liability insurance, into one convenient policy for businesses.
General Liability
Helps protect your business from claims involving bodily injury, property damage, and personal or advertising injury.
Business Umbrella
An extra layer of liability protection beyond what is provided on your business insurance policies.

General Liability Insurance helps cover claims involving:
- Bodily injury
- Property damage
- Personal and advertising injury
- Legal defense costs
For example, if a customer slips and falls at your business, General Liability Insurance may help cover medical expenses and legal costs.
